Burning of magnesium (or anything else) requires continuing combination with oxygen. If a burning piece of magnesium is transferred to an atmosphere of nitrogen, no additional magnesium can react with oxygen because none is available for reaction.
No. It would be very bad for us if they did, ad out atmosphere is mostly nitrogen and oxygen. Nitrogen will react with oxygen, but only at high temperatures, and the process actually absorbs more energy than it gives out.
